The size of Cape Burney is approximately 19.2 square kilometres. It has 1 park covering nearly 0.1% of total area. The population of Cape Burney in 2016 was 500 people. By 2021 the population was 538 showing a population growth of 7.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Cape Burney is 50-59 years. Households in Cape Burney are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Cape Burney work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 73.50% of the homes in Cape Burney were owner-occupied compared with 73.30% in 2016.
